Question 2: The fluorescence of diamond is another index different from the 4C parameter of diamond, which can be used as an auxiliary index to evaluate the quality of diamond. This indicator is not marked on the domestic certificate at all, and the sales staff of jewelry stores rarely mention it to customers, but everyone in the industry knows that the degree of fluorescence does affect the price.
Let me first introduce the fluorescence of diamonds, which means that diamonds will emit colored light such as blue light or yellow light under strong ultraviolet radiation. According to the intensity grade, it is divided into five grades: none (slight), weak (moderate) and strong (very strong). In natural light, we can't feel it, except in the summer sun with strong ultraviolet rays, diamonds with strong fluorescence grade may be felt by naked eyes, and slight fluorescence grade is difficult to detect, so in most cases, fluorescence has no effect on our daily wear.
Under normal circumstances, can you distinguish the following diamonds with different fluorescence grades?
Fluorescence is a natural indicator, not an artificially added factor, and it has no effect on the quality of diamond itself. However, considering that the luster of diamonds will be impure, the price of diamonds with fluorescence will be lower than that without fluorescence, and the higher the fluorescence grade, the lower the price. Especially for some diamonds with high color clarity, the price gap between fluorescent and non-fluorescent is even greater. Actually, it's quite understandable when you think about it. People who have the financial strength to buy high-quality diamonds naturally want to be as perfect as possible in all aspects, and so do fluorescence indicators. Therefore, some diamonds with high color, high purity and strong fluorescence will naturally be cheaper because few people are interested.
Having said that, you should also have a general understanding of fluorescence. Here are some professional suggestions: if you buy diamonds mainly for daily wear, you don't have to consider the fluorescence problem, at least slight or moderate fluorescence can be considered; If the selected diamond has a high parameter level, or there are some considerations about investment preservation, then try to choose non-fluorescent diamonds.

Question 3: What is the fluorescence of diamonds? There are many kinds of precious stones, which will emit light similar to fluorescence under the irradiation of short-wave light (usually ultraviolet light) invisible to the naked eye. This is called fluorescence reaction. Diamonds don't necessarily glow, but most don't. The fluorescence of diamonds with fluorescence reaction is recorded in the certificate as VS (strongest fluorescence), S (strong fluorescence), Med (medium fluorescence) and F (slight fluorescence). And record its color at the same time, at most blue and yellow. If the fluorescence of a diamond is F, it is impossible to tell what color it is. The record of fluorescence reaction on the certificate helps to identify diamonds. Some diamonds with strong fluorescence reaction have poor transparency and look like soapy water, which is detrimental to the appearance. The fluorescence levels are divided into VS (strongest fluorescence), S (strong fluorescence), Med (moderate fluorescence), F (slight fluorescence) and Non (no fluorescence). Diamonds with strong fluorescence will have poor permeability under light irradiation. So the stronger the fluorescence, the cheaper the price.

According to the GIA standard, the fluorescence of loose diamonds can be divided into five grades: Non (none), f (weak), Med (medium), s (strong) and VS (very strong). The fluorescence grade of diamonds with D-G color above 50 points has a great influence on the price of diamonds with VS grade or above. Medium fluorescence will affect the price by about 5%- 10%, while strong fluorescence will be 30% cheaper.
The stronger the fluorescence, the greater the influence on the almost colorless color, and the hazy feeling (10 times clearer under the mirror) will be produced under the light irradiation, which will affect the brightness and permeability of high-colored diamonds. For diamonds below J color, although blue fluorescence can make diamonds appear white, the price will still be 5%- 10% lower. Small diamonds below 20 cents basically do not affect the price. More than 20 points have a certain price impact. Domestic testing centers do not grade and comment on fluorescence because of the fixed testing level, but because most diamonds are imported, the price changes with the pricing standards in the international market. Therefore, many diamonds with strong fluorescence sell at the same price as diamonds without fluorescence, which is a great loss to consumers.
In order to ensure the value of your diamond, if your diamond is above 20 points, be sure to ask the seller about the fluorescence grade of the diamond, and compare the transparency of the diamond under strong light and soft light after receiving the goods. If the permeability of a diamond is much worse under strong light, then your diamond is likely to have strong fluorescence.
